Ditch clearing services involve the removal of obstructions such as debris, overgrown vegetation, and accumulated sediment from drainage ditches, waterways, or stormwater channels. These services typically include the use of specialized equipment like excavators, loaders, and brush cutters to effectively clear and maintain these areas. The goal is to ensure that water can flow freely through the ditches, preventing blockages that could lead to flooding or water damage. Regular ditch clearing is essential for maintaining proper drainage,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or with significant land development.
This service helps address common problems associated with clogged or overgrown drainage systems. When ditches become obstructed with debris, sediment buildup, or invasive plants, they can impede water flow, resulting in localized flooding, erosion, or water pooling. Over time, neglected ditches may also become breeding grounds for pests or cause damage to nearby infrastructure. Ditch clearing services help mitigate these issues by restoring the natural flow of water, reducing the risk of flooding, and preventing property damage caused by water accumulation.

Equipment and Labor Costs - Ditch clearing services typically range from $500 to $2,500 depending on the size and complexity of the project. Small to medium-sized ditches may cost around $500 to $1,200, while larger or more difficult projects can reach $2,000 or more.
Per-Linear-Foot Pricing - Many contractors charge between $3 and $8 per linear foot for ditch clearing. For example, clearing a 50-foot ditch could cost approximately $150 to $400, depending on terrain and obstructions.
Additional Services and Materials - Costs may increase if additional work such as debris removal or erosion control is needed, often adding $200 to $1,000 to the total. Material costs, like gravel or fill, are usually billed separately based on project scope.
Project Size and Accessibility - Larger or hard-to-access ditches tend to cost more, with prices varying widely. For example, a small accessible ditch might be on the lower end of the range, while extensive or difficult terrain can push costs upward of $3,000 or more.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
